CFH Variants Affect Structural and Functional Brain Changes and Genetic Risk of Alzheimer's Disease
The immune response is highly active in Alzheimer's disease (AD). Identification of genetic risk contributed by immune genes to AD may provide essential insight for the prognosis, diagnosis, and treatment of this neurodegenerative disease. In this study, we performed a genetic screening for AD-...
